Subject: [PATCH 11/18] OMAP2 clock: don't compile OMAP2430-only functions on non-2430 builds

omap2430_clk_i2chs_find_idlest() doesn't need to be compiled in on
non-2430 builds, so skip it in those cases to save memory.

arch/arm/mach-omap2/clock2xxx.c | 6 ++++++
1 files changed, 6 insertions(+), 0 deletions(-)
diff --git a/arch/arm/mach-omap2/clock2xxx.c b/arch/arm/mach-omap2/clock2xxx.c
index b59cb1d..e5b9851 100644
--- a/arch/arm/mach-omap2/clock2xxx.c
+++ b/arch/arm/mach-omap2/clock2xxx.c
@@ -50,6 +50,8 @@ struct clk *vclk, *sclk, *dclk;
* Omap24xx specific clock functions
*-------------------------------------------------------------------------*/
+#ifdef CONFIG_ARCH_OMAP2430
+
/**
* omap2430_clk_i2chs_find_idlest - return CM_IDLEST info for 2430 I2CHS
* @clk: struct clk * being enabled
@@ -69,6 +71,10 @@ static void omap2430_clk_i2chs_find_idlest(struct clk *clk,
*idlest_bit = clk->enable_bit;
}
+#else
+#define omap2430_clk_i2chs_find_idlest NULL
+#endif
+
/* 2430 I2CHS has non-standard IDLEST register */
const struct clkops clkops_omap2430_i2chs_wait = {
.enable = omap2_dflt_clk_enable,
